Thiri Mingalar Kabar Aye Pagoda Buddha Pujaniya festival scheduled to take place

Thiri Mingalar Kabar Aye Pagoda’s 72nd Buddha Pujaniya Festival has been scheduled to take place next month lively, according to the pagoda’s trustee board.

The 5-day festival from 21 February to 25 February will feature Htamane offering, food offering, rice donation and offering to Buddha, Dhamma and Sanga.

“With donors and departments in townships of our Mayangon district, we have made sure that the festival to be held lively,” said an official from the trustee board.

The recitation of Maha Pathana Treatise will be held throughout the 5-day festival and Htamane making festival will be taken place on 22 February and 23 February in morning, and the consecration ceremony of the pagoda and other ceremonies will be taken place on 25 February.

“Before Covid-19 happened, we held the festival with fun activities in the whole five-day period. Now, we don’t add fun activities for some reasons,” said the trustees’ official.
